How it feels
You command a grim undead army in methodical, brutal turn-based battles, managing resources from slain foes to upgrade your forces.

What players say
Players compare Iratus to Darkest Dungeon but find it more forgiving and simpler. The game focuses on preparing your undead squad in the lobby, while actual battles feel repetitive and samey across a campaign that takes over 100 fights to finish. Some enjoy the dark humor and combo potential, while others call it a boring clone that lacks Darkest Dungeon's tension and charm.
